Rockford, MI Late Fee Limits 2026

Late fees in Rockford must be reasonable. Charge more and tenants sue to recover — courts void excessive fees regardless of what the lease says.

In Michigan, late fees must be reasonable and proportional to actual damages from late payment. There is no specific statutory cap, but courts void excessive fees. Grace periods are typically set by the lease.
